What Drives Price
Material choice and site conditions are the dominant price drivers. In Michigan, shores with soft muck or exposed roots require more stabilization and backfill, pushing cost toward the higher end. Seawalls near boat launches or marinas may need reinforced connections and corrosion protection, adding a premium. The selected wall type—timber, vinyl, steel, or concrete—largely sets both the per-foot cost and the installation timeline.
Other influential factors include water depth and tide range, access to the site, and environmental constraints that trigger special permits or timing windows. Long runs without breaks may reduce per-foot costs through economies of scale, but complex layouts or variable slopes can increase labor time and material waste.
Ways To Save
Choose mid-range materials and optimize site planning to reduce costs. For Michigan projects, consider durable vinyl or treated timber as a balance between cost and longevity. Schedule work in shoulder seasons to avoid peak demand and potential permit backlogs. If feasible, combine seawall replacement with adjacent shoreline improvements to share mobilization costs and use a single permit package.
Pursue precise measurements and a detailed scope to minimize change orders. Request quotes that separately itemize materials, labor, and permits so that adjustments target the right line items. Where permissions allow, install modular components that can be expanded later rather than a full rebuild.

Labor & Installation Time
Installation time depends on wall type and site access. Basic timber installations may take 1–2 days per 100 feet in straightforward sites, while concrete or steel systems can require several days to weeks, including curing, anchoring, and backfilling. Labor rates in Michigan commonly range from $60 to $120 per hour for skilled installers, with crew sizes of 2–4 workers on typical projects.

Real-World Pricing Examples
Basic Scenario
Spec: simple timber wall, mild slope, accessible shoreline. Length: 100 ft. Assumptions: standard backfill, no permits beyond local building permit.
Estimated: $9,500 total; $95 per foot; labor 1–2 workers, 1 day; materials lighter and installation simpler.
Mid-Range Scenario
Spec: vinyl panels with concrete footer, moderate slope, easy access. Length: 150 ft. Assumptions: basic permits, standard backfill, some trenching.
Estimated: $46,500 total; $310 per foot; labor 2–3 workers over 3–5 days; includes delivery and disposal.
Premium Scenario
Spec: reinforced concrete wall with steel anchors, steep bank, poor access. Length: 200 ft. Assumptions: multiple permits, environmental constraints, extensive excavation.
Estimated: $238,000 total; $1,190 per foot; labor 4–6 workers over 2–3 weeks; includes high-end materials and comprehensive cleanup.
